Symptoms

Consider the following scenario:

  • You have a Windows Server 2012 R2 Essentials-based domain controller.

  • You configure client backup settings on the domain controller.

  • Active Directory Domain Services (AD DS) is not available on the domain controller. You start the Windows Server Essentials Management Service (WseMgmtSvc).

In this scenario, all client backup settings are removed from the domain controller.

Cause

This issue occurs because the PrincipalContext function is not blocked when there are no domain controllers available in the domain environment. The PrincipalContext function is created for each domain controller. When AD DS is not available on a domain controller, the function returns an empty value of the domain controller. Therefore, all client backup settings are removed from the domain controller by the device refresh task.

Resolution

Update information

To resolve this issue, install update rollup 2887595. For more information about how to obtain this update rollup package, click the following article number to view the article in the Microsoft Knowledge Base:

2887595 Windows RT 8.1, Windows 8.1, and Windows Server 2012 R2 update rollup: November 2013
